Got A Lot Of Dust On Your Dirt Roads? 4 Ways You Can Control It
If you have unpaved roads, dust is a given, especially on those hot, dry days. Dust can be dangerous, as it can reduce visibility when driving as well as cause respiratory problems. Fortunately, there are many things you can do to get the dust down to a minimum, four of which are listed below.
Use Gravel
Cover the dirt road with gravel to reduce dust. Gravel gives the vehicles a hard surface, and it also protects the soils that can be damaged by vehicle wheels.
